Process

Working from raw green screen rehearsal footage provided by Jim Henson Studios, I selected key character moments using Adobe Premiere Pro. After exporting still frames, I masked and composited the characters in Adobe Photoshop, carefully balancing their sizes, expressions, and interactions to create a theatrical, high-energy layout.

The most technically challenging aspect was isolating the characters from the green screen, especially those with fur or soft edges, and creating consistent lighting and shadowing across the composition. The final image was built to feel dramatic yet joyful—evoking the spirit of the show while standing out in busy onboard environments and marketing channels.
